Narrative:Avro Lancaster B Mk. III PB983/6O-A, 582 Squadron, RAF: Written off (destroyed) 28 April 1945 when crashed at RAF Deenethorpe, Deenethorpe, 5 miles ENE of Corby, Northamptonshire.
On a training flight on the 28 April 1945, Lancaster PB983 took off from RAF Little Stoughton, Huntingdon, Cambridgeshire, but iced up after flying into a snow cloud and lost power on both port engines. At 100 feet, all control was lost and the aircraft crashed at 11:50 hours near Deenethorpe airfield, 5 miles east north east from the centre of Corby, Northamptonshire. Two of the crew members were killed in the crash and the other five were injured.
The crew members of PB983 were:
Flying Officer Robert Patrick Terpening DFC (424312) (Pilot) - Killed
Pilot Officer John Grylls Watson DFM (424485) (Air Gunner) - Killed
Warrant Officer Arnold Andreas Anderson DFC (426001) (Wireless Air Gunner) Injured, Discharged from the RAAF: 14 March 1946
Flight Lieutenant A E C Derrett (82961) (RAFVR) (First Navigator) Injured
Aircraftman Class II R G Lloyd (3036306) (RAFVR) (Supernumerary) Injured
Warrant Officer Allan William McIlrath, DFC (428985) (Mid Upper Gunner) Injured, Discharged from the RAAF: 14 March 1946
Pilot Officer R A B Newman (1868086) (RAFVR) (Second Navigator) Injured
Both crew fatalities were Commemorated at Cambridge City Cemetery, Cambridge, United Kingdom. Lest We Forget
